Mesothelioma lawsuits don't usually include class action lawsuits. The Supreme Court has ruled that it is unfair to include asbestos patients of the present and future in one class, as their exposure histories and illnesses are different enough to be considered members of the same group. This and other decisions against certifying classes resulted in mesothelioma cases being primarily tried as mass torts or individual lawsuits.
